Pianist at Quincy Tomorrow

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Three great piano classics and a modern work on its way to becoming a classic make up the program of the concert to be presented by the Quincy-Holmes Arts Festival tomorrow at 8:30 p.m. in the Quincy Dining Hall.

Guest artist Victor Rosenbaum, one of the outstanding pianists of the younger generation, will perform the Mozart Sonata in E-Flat, K. 282; the Beethoven Sonata in E-Major, Op. 109; the Schubert Sonata in A-Minor, Op. 42; and the Webern Plane Variations, Op. 27.
